Transaction df24d4336bf91dee43412261731aa066b5dcebacb9457323a9dced55b067d700
1 Input
1 Output
-
df24d4336bf91dee43412261731aa066b5dcebacb9457323a9dced55b067d700:0
- value
- 16776972
- script pubkey
- OP_0 OP_PUSHBYTES_20 360836fd00fc42dd44371eb26d9a3463ec35af68
- address
- bc1qxcyrdlgql3pd63phr6exmx35v0krttmgs4jyje